Description

Delve into the Clare Marchant Collection, a trio of captivating historical novels that intertwine the past and the present, revealing secrets that challenge the boundaries of time.

The Plot

This collection features:

  • The Secrets of Saffron Hall: Set against the backdrop of a crumbling estate, this novel explores the life of a young woman who uncovers her family's hidden past, leading to revelations that could alter her future.
  • The Queen's Spy: A gripping tale of intrigue and espionage, where a determined spy must navigate court politics and deception to uncover the truth about a dangerous plot against the crown.
  • The Mapmaker's Daughter: This narrative follows a spirited heroine who embarks on a journey to reclaim her identity, armed with her father's maps and the knowledge that the world is much larger than she ever imagined.

Themes

Each novel in this collection explores themes of identity, legacy, and the unbreakable ties of family. Marchant's characters are intricately developed, allowing readers to connect deeply with their struggles and triumphs.

Writing Style

Clare Marchant's prose is both lyrical and engaging, drawing readers into richly detailed settings. Her ability to weave historical facts with fictional narratives adds depth to the storytelling, making each book not only entertaining but also enlightening.
